The Opportunity

Description

We're looking for a Workplace Service Coordinator, working in IT (excluding Telecommunication) industry in Chicago, Illinois, United States.

  • Work with and get direction from the Associate Manager of Workplace Services to maintain and provide excellent customer service and support to the office.
  • Assist internal customers (employees) with all Workplace Services related items.
  • Greet and direct guests in a timely and professional manner.
  • Assign temporary and guest badges as required.
  • Ensure all guests are properly signed into the Visitor Log system. Notify staff of visitors, candidates, customer arrivals.
  • Complete a daily check of temporary access cards, ensure all cards are accounted for and returned daily. Maintain an electronic list of access cards assigned to staff, providing lost or damaged access card numbers to the security team for cancellation.
  • Maintain a presence on instant messaging app Slack, sending periodic reminders and updates. Respond to and follow up on all incoming emails and in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Pre register guests for meetings, events and interview candidates.
  • Assist with overall maintenance of the organization, communicate any and all maintenance issues with building management in a timely and efficient manner
